2006 Audi S6 vs. 2002 Toyota Corolla

To start off, 2006 Audi S6 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Toyota Corolla.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Toyota Corolla would be higher. At 5,204 cc (10 cylinders), 2006 Audi S6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Audi S6 (420 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 331 more horse power than 2002 Toyota Corolla. (89 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Audi S6 should accelerate faster than 2002 Toyota Corolla.

Because 2006 Audi S6 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2002 Toyota Corolla.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Audi S6 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Audi S6 (732 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 605 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Toyota Corolla. (127 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 2006 Audi S6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Toyota Corolla.
